Future Outlook: Road Side Drug Testing Devices Market Through 2035
Overview of Road Side Drug Testing Devices Market
The Global Road Side Drug Testing Devices Market is witnessing significant growth due to increasing concerns about road safety and substance abuse among drivers. Law enforcement agencies across the globe are deploying advanced drug testing technologies to deter impaired driving and enhance public safety. These devices are designed to quickly detect the presence of narcotics such as cannabis, cocaine, amphetamines, opiates, and other illegal substances using saliva, breath, or sweat. Governments are implementing stricter regulations and zero-tolerance policies for drug-impaired driving, thereby boosting demand for these devices.
The Road Side Drug Testing Devices Market is valued at USD 460.72 Million in 2024 and is projected to reach a value of USD 867.5 Million by 2035 at a CAGR (Compound Annual Growth Rate) of 5.95% between 2025 and 2035. Additionally, the rising number of road accidents caused by drug-influenced drivers is prompting the development and adoption of faster, more reliable, and user-friendly roadside testing equipment. The combination of regulatory backing and technological advancements is expected to propel the market forward in the coming years.

Top Trends in the Road Side Drug Testing Devices Market
Several top trends are currently reshaping the Road Side Drug Testing Devices Market, reflecting the broader shift towards smart policing and digital law enforcement. One major trend is the rise in saliva-based testing over blood and urine tests. Saliva tests are non-invasive, easier to administer, and offer quicker results, making them ideal for roadside conditions. As such, manufacturers are focusing on improving the sensitivity and accuracy of saliva-based test kits.
Another trend is the integration of digital connectivity within testing devices. Modern units are now equipped with Bluetooth or wireless technology, enabling instant transmission of test results to centralized databases. This reduces paperwork and minimizes errors, making it easier for agencies to compile and analyze data over time. Additionally, multi-panel drug testing kits that can detect multiple substances simultaneously are gaining popularity due to their cost efficiency and comprehensive detection capabilities.
Sustainability is also becoming a focus, with many manufacturers developing eco-friendly, disposable components. Furthermore, AI and machine learning technologies are starting to influence the market, especially in enhancing detection accuracy and minimizing false positives. With these trends gaining traction, the industry is moving towards a future defined by convenience, speed, and reliability in field drug testing.

Challenges in the Road Side Drug Testing Devices Market
Despite its growth potential, the Road Side Drug Testing Devices Market faces several notable challenges. One of the major issues is the possibility of false positives or false negatives, which can lead to legal complications and wrongful detentions. These inaccuracies can undermine the credibility of roadside tests and hinder broader adoption. Additionally, varying legal standards and testing protocols across countries and even states can make it difficult for companies to develop universally accepted devices.
Privacy concerns also remain a challenge, especially regarding how data from these tests is stored and used. The initial high cost of acquiring advanced testing equipment can also be a barrier for smaller jurisdictions or developing nations. Furthermore, the lack of skilled personnel to operate sophisticated devices and interpret test results accurately adds to the complexity. These challenges highlight the need for better training, technological improvements, and globally harmonized testing standards.

Regional Analysis – Focus on North America
North America is the dominant region in the Road Side Drug Testing Devices Market, primarily due to its stringent traffic regulations and high awareness about the dangers of drug-impaired driving. The U.S., in particular, has been at the forefront, with several states adopting zero-tolerance laws and launching large-scale awareness campaigns. Law enforcement agencies across the region have received increased funding to modernize their equipment and training programs, creating a robust ecosystem for the deployment of roadside drug testing devices.
The presence of key market players in the region, such as Abbott Laboratories and Intoximeters Inc., ensures easy access to advanced technologies. Furthermore, collaborative initiatives between federal agencies like the National Highway Traffic Safety Administration (NHTSA) and private companies are encouraging innovation and deployment of smart testing devices. The growing legalization of marijuana in various U.S. states has also led to a rise in demand for accurate detection tools that can distinguish between current impairment and historical use, prompting further technological advancements.
Canada is also experiencing a surge in the adoption of these devices, particularly after the legalization of cannabis. With ongoing investments in public safety infrastructure and digital policing tools, North America is expected to maintain its lead in both innovation and market size throughout the forecast period.
